Harlan County suffered a pair of varsity losses Thursday at Knox Central, falling 47-39 to Pineville and 43-27 to Knox Central.
Eighth-grade guard Taylynn Napier scored 10 to lead the Lady Bears against Pienville. Jaycee Simpson scored seven. Kenadee Sturgill and Kylee Runions added six each. Raegan Landa and Reagan Clem each scored four. Jaylee Cochran added two.
Napier scored 12 and Runions added 11 to lead Harlan County (3-6) against Knox Central. Cochran tossed in eight points. Clem scored five. Simpson added four. Whitney Noe scored two.
———
Harlan County improved to 7-0 in junior varsity action with a 43-27 win over Knox Central.
Napier poured in 18 to lead HCHS. Vanessa Griffith and Landa added seven and six points, respectively. Natalie Moore and Kelsie Middleton each scored four. Sturgill and Shasta Brackett each scored two.
